Did you know that December is the most popular month to get engaged? Next to December is February with Valentine’s Day. In the spirit of engagement season and wedding season on the horizon, I’m sharing some of our favorite weddings with you that are still trending in 2015.

Sara + Gabe NYE Wedding Sarah Sofia Productions

Dessert bars, exposed brick and industrial spaces with a lounge vibe were gaining popularity in 2010 and are still trending in 2015. Sara + Abe got married on NYE in 2010, which remains a popular wedding date. Get the details of their wedding here.

Christina and Sam Winter Wedding || Sarah Sofia Productions

Winter weddings were trending in 2011 and are still hot in 2015! As are small, intimate weddings. I was honored to plan and style one of my best friends weddings at their favorite French restaurant! Christina wanted an elegant but simple décor with blue and white. Blue and white is classic and will always be in style. Get the details of Christina and Sam’s Winter Wedding here.

Sophisticated and memorable food and experience at weddings started trending in 2008 and hasn’t stop since!  While some might argue you never remember the food at weddings, that wasn’t the case at our wedding and most of the weddings and events I plan and style. Our intimate wedding of 80 guests at The Ritz Carlton Sarasota Beach Club is still talked about amongst our friends as being one of the most memorable; who could forget that lobster bisque!

Sarasota Coral and Cornflower Blue Wedding || Sarah Sofia Productions

Other trends such as the signature drink, coordination of color and theme throughout the wedding, and destination weddings in 2009 are still hot in 2015. Not to mention my favorite colors coral and blue are hot trends this year not only in fashion and interior design, but are seeing variations of the colors in weddings and events. I know a few people thought the color coral was bold and was fitting for a beach wedding, but wouldn’t reach mainstream.
